More storage space for criminal court records is among the New Orleans city projects that will be placed before the voters this fall.

City Council scheduled a November 15th election for a $415 million bond issue to fund a list of city projects.

One of them will be renovation and additional storage space for the Orleans Parish Criminal District Court Clerk's office.

Gov. Jeff Landry has ordered the state police to investigate why New Orleans Public Works dumped Orleans Parish criminal court case records into a landfill.
